NEW ZEALAND.
(Br Telegraph.)
Gas Extension. NAPIER, June 18. The gas company to-day decided to increase its capital from £2OOO to £SOOO. -
Judges’ ArrangementsJustice Connolly will take the Napier Session at the Supreme Court, Judge Edwards that of Nelson and Blenheim.
The “ Heresy Hur.it- ”
DUNEDIN, June 18
The Dunedin Presbytery is considering the “ heresy hunt ” to day and it is being warmly debated. A mol ion exonerating Mr Gibbs has been proposed and seconded. The discussion will last all day. Mr Gibbs justifies his language. Gold Yields.
The Gallant Tipperary have got 168 ounces of amalgam from 100 tons of stouo.
Serious Spill
Through falling over a precipice of quite 40ft at th) head of Woodhaugh Valley Road, Mrs Waikins, a daughter of Mr Ross, M.H.R. when proceeding homeward last night sustained concussion of the spine more or less severe, besides other injuries. The spot is a dangerous one, insecurely fenced.
